Senior Manager, Consumer & Shopper Connection Planning - Flavor Sparkling

1 week ago Shanghai, China

FOCUS & SCOPE:

Fanta holds a prestigious position as the third-largest sparkling soft drink brand for The Coca-Cola Company and is identified as a cornerstone of the company's key growth. In 2026, our ambition is to recruit new consumers by diving into youth's passion for anime and gaming and integrating Fanta into their daily moment of relaxation and fun.

The Senior Connection Planning Manager will be performed as the leader of Fanta 2026 full year consumer & shopper engagement from E2E, including:

  • Fanta brand equity building in summer: lead negotiation with 2 Top ACG gaming IP in paid media investment against national and local media (digital, OOH, etc.) and customer media (in-store, etc... ), social and on-ground experiential... responsible for full IMC campaign from planning to execution.
  • Always-on activation for youth ritual building in campus & snacking channel, act as the expert of shopper channel behavior and social trends and translate these trends, business objectives, and brand strategies into always-on campus activation and snacking channel optimization.
  • Trade focus acceleration plan for transaction and advocacy (theme park): partner with cross function team of Brand, Commercial & Customer teams, franchise bottler to deliver integrated communications programs to close the loop of digital impressions, social conversations, and actions through to transactions and advocacy.

On top of above, this role requires:

  • Exceptional communication skills that can lead external partners to achieve the best possible outcomes;
  • Knowledge of external media landscape (agencies, content companies, suppliers of products/experiences etc.) to identify optimal execution and deals where appropriate;
  • Always find innovative ways to create differentiated programs that inspire consumers to choose Fanta.
